Due to its legal form as a foundation, the Pension Fund Swiss Re is a legal entity in its own right and therefore operates independently.

The Pension Fund Board is the supreme governing body of the Pension Fund Swiss Re. Its members are elected for a term of three years. The current term started on 1 January 2024 and will end on 31 December 2026. An equal  number of employees representatives and employers representatives sit on the Board.

Due to the existing structure (Pension Fund with several affiliated companies), the elections to the Pension Fund Board were held based on the electoral regulations - Appendix E to the plan regulations.

The Pension Fund Board elects a Managing Director.

 

The Pension Fund Board is entrusted with the following duties:

  • issuing and making amendments to the Pension Fund regulations;
  • setting an asset allocation strategy;
  • monitoring management and asset allocation.
